The bread shop located at Aulong (One of the place in Taiping). The bread shop just opposite the Cheong Fat Restaurant (You will know it if you are Taiping Kia or Gal). The bread shop opens from 2.30pm until 11.00pm, Monday close.

If you have seen the photo above, they have stated in the signboard on the wall outsides the bread shop that they are cater for :

1) Wedding Ceremony
2) Birthday Party
3) Function Gathering
4) Open House Party
5) Full Moon Ceremony

You can call to order or step in. What I can tell you is, the price is very very cheap, you can get a discount if you buy in large quantity. If you are Taiping Kia or Gal, or you travel to Taiping, don’t forget to try this !
